The Lore of Kaldorei

Immersed in ancient mysticism, the Kaldorei, commonly known as Night Elves, have safeguarded Azeroth since time immemorial. You’d recognize them by their towering presence, luminous eyes, and an affinity for nature that’s unparalleled. Their history is woven with the tapestry of Azeroth itself, marked by their devotion to the Moon Goddess, Elune, whose guidance steers their fates.

You’ve likely heard of Malfurion Stormrage, the revered archdruid whose power and wisdom have become synonymous with the night elven identity. His leadership, alongside his brother Illidan’s more tumultuous tale, has defined much of the Kaldorei’s legacy. But there are other heroes too, like Maiev Shadowsong, the relentless warden who chased Illidan across realms, and her brother, Jarod Shadowsong, a commander whose tactics have saved countless lives.

Earning the Heritage Armor

To don the revered Night Elf Heritage Armor, you must first prove your dedication to the Kaldorei legacy through a series of challenging in-game achievements.

This isn’t just a walk in the park; you’ve got to roll up your sleeves and dive deep into the World of Warcraft’s rich tapestry of quests and lore.

Firstly, you’ll need to level a Night Elf character to the current maximum without any shortcuts like character boosts or race changes. It’s a journey that’ll test your mettle, but as you grind through those levels, you’re not only honing your skills but also soaking up the history that makes Night Elves so iconic.

Once you hit that level cap, a special quest line becomes available, one that’s steeped in Night Elf culture and history. You’ll embark on an epic narrative that takes you across familiar territories and into the heart of what it means to be a protector of Azeroth.

Completing this quest line is your key to unlocking the armor set.
